The Net Present Value (NPV) of Gao Enterprises' project is calculated by discounting the expected annual cash flows back to the present value at the firm's required rate of return and then subtracting the initial investment.
Using the formula for NPV we have:
NPV = (Cash Flow / (1 + r)^t) - Initial Investment
- Where:
- Cash Flow is the annual cash inflow, which is $1,100,000.
- r is the required rate of return, which is 18% or 0.18 as a decimal.
- t is the number of years, which spans from 1 to 10.
The individual present values of the cash flows are summed and then the initial investment is subtracted to obtain the NPV.
